




Resumen: Buscamos un Ingeniero Full Stack con sólida experiencia en backend y DevOps para construir, escalar y operar los sistemas centrales de una plataforma que combate el cambio climático. Puntos destacados: 1. Contribuir a una plataforma de microservicios utilizando Kotlin, garantizando un alto rendimiento. 2. Diseñar, construir y mantener infraestructura en la nube en AWS mediante Terraform. 3. Utilizar activamente herramientas de desarrollo impulsadas por IA y promover su uso para mejorar la velocidad de desarrollo. Sobre nosotros La misión de Leap es combatir el cambio climático al permitir una red eléctrica fiable que funcione con energía limpia. La red eléctrica está pasando de combustibles fósiles contaminantes (pero predecibles) a energías renovables limpias (pero menos predecibles). Para lograrlo, la red necesita una demanda y una oferta más flexibles que ayuden a mantener su estabilidad y fiabilidad. Leap desempeña un papel crucial al abrir los mercados mayoristas de energía a todos los recursos energéticos distribuidos, permitiendo que nuestros socios reciban pagos por brindar flexibilidad a la red. Leap es una empresa tecnológica privada financiada por importantes fondos de capital riesgo y reconocidos emprendedores del sector energético. Somos una organización remota y distribuida, con miembros del equipo ubicados en todo el mundo, en Europa y Norteamérica. **Descripción general** Buscamos un Ingeniero Full Stack con fuerte enfoque en backend y sólida experiencia en DevOps para ayudarnos a construir, escalar y operar los sistemas centrales que impulsan nuestra plataforma. Este no es un rol especializado y estrecho. Inicialmente se espera que dediques aproximadamente: * 50 % al desarrollo backend * 40 % a DevOps / infraestructura / fiabilidad * 10 % al trabajo frontend Buscamos explícitamente ingenieros que ya tengan cierta experiencia práctica en las tres áreas y disfruten trabajar a lo largo de toda la pila, incluso si tienen una clara «base principal» en backend o infraestructura. Trabajarás estrechamente con los equipos de producto e ingeniería para diseñar sistemas escalables, implementar funciones de extremo a extremo y garantizar que nuestra plataforma siga siendo fiable, segura y eficiente a medida que crezcamos. **Principales responsabilidades** * Contribuir al desarrollo backend dentro de nuestra plataforma de microservicios basada en Kotlin, garantizando alto rendimiento, claridad y fiabilidad. * Trabajar estrechamente con los equipos de producto y diseño para comprender las necesidades de los usuarios, definir la dirección del producto y validar rápidamente ideas mediante prototipos y experimentos. * Colaborar con otros equipos de producto para asegurar que las nuevas funciones se integren sin problemas con nuestra arquitectura orientada a eventos, flujos Kafka y servicios de dominio. * Participar en turnos de guardia, respuesta ante incidencias, análisis de causas raíz y revisiones posteriores a incidentes, impulsando así la mejora continua. * Diseñar, construir y mantener infraestructura en la nube en AWS mediante Infraestructura como Código (Terraform). * Operar y mejorar sistemas productivos basados en Kubernetes, garantizando disponibilidad, rendimiento y resiliencia. * Construir y mantener canalizaciones CI/CD (GitLab) para permitir implementaciones rápidas, seguras y repetibles. * Mejorar la observabilidad en toda la pila (métricas, registros, trazado, alertas, SLO, paneles de control) utilizando Datadog y otras herramientas relacionadas. * Ayudar a eliminar tareas repetitivas mediante automatización, herramientas y mejores procesos. * Asegurar las mejores prácticas de seguridad en infraestructura y aplicaciones (IAM, redes, gestión de secretos, análisis de vulnerabilidades). * Realizar pequeños o medianos cambios frontend (React) para apoyar nuevas funciones o mejorar la experiencia de usuario. * Colaborar con ingenieros especializados en frontend y diseñadores cuando sea necesario. * Sentirse cómodo navegando y modificando bases de código frontend existentes, incluso si no es tu enfoque principal. * Utilizar activamente y promover herramientas de ingeniería impulsadas por IA (por ejemplo, Claude Code, GitHub Copilot) para mejorar la velocidad de desarrollo, la calidad del código y la capacidad de aprovechamiento en todo el equipo de ingeniería. **Beneficios** **Cualificaciones y requisitos** * 5 o más años de experiencia profesional como ingeniero de software, con exposición práctica al desarrollo backend, DevOps/infraestructura y algo de trabajo frontend. * Habilidades sólidas en ingeniería backend, con dominio de al menos un lenguaje de programación backend utilizado en entornos productivos. * Capacidad y disposición para completar una tarea de programación en una solución basada en JVM (Kotlin preferido) como parte del proceso de entrevista. Experiencia profesional previa con Kotlin es un plus, pero no es obligatoria. * Experiencia práctica sólida con AWS (por ejemplo, EC2, EKS, RDS, S3, VPC, IAM). * Experiencia práctica con Infraestructura como Código, preferiblemente Terraform. * Experiencia operando aplicaciones en Kubernetes, incluyendo despliegues, manifiestos, Helm y depuración. * Familiaridad con sistemas CI/CD, preferiblemente GitLab CI/CD. * Experiencia con herramientas de observabilidad y monitoreo (por ejemplo, Datadog, Prometheus, Grafana, OpenTelemetry). * Capacidad para escribir código y scripts productivos (por ejemplo, Kotlin, Python, Go, Bash). * Conocimientos básicos de tecnologías frontend modernas y capacidad para realizar cambios frontend pequeños o medianos. * Profundo conocimiento de sistemas distribuidos, fundamentos de redes y compromisos en el diseño de sistemas. * Conocimientos prácticos de prácticas modernas de seguridad, incluyendo IAM, gestión de secretos y endurecimiento de infraestructura. * Residencia en la zona horaria europea y dominio fluido del inglés tanto hablado como escrito. * Competencia en el uso de herramientas de ingeniería impulsadas por IA (por ejemplo, Claude Code, GitHub Copilot) y firme convicción sobre su valor como parte fundamental de los flujos de trabajo modernos de desarrollo de software. * Experiencia trabajando en entornos remotos o híbridos, o demostración de la capacidad de ser productivo y comprometido, gestionar bien el tiempo, trabajar de forma independiente y tener éxito en un entorno completamente remoto. * Disposición a ser flexible respecto al horario laboral. Leap es una empresa con sede en Estados Unidos, y aunque gran parte de tu trabajo se realiza durante el horario habitual de oficina (9 a 5), se valora mucho la capacidad de ajustar ocasionalmente dicho horario.


